"Focusing on Don Quixote, Frederick A. de Armas unearths links between Cervantes' text and frescoes, paintings, and sculptures by Italian artists such as Cambiaso, Michelangelo, Raphael, and Titian. His study seeks to re-engage the critics of today by formulating the link between Cervantes and the Renaissance through an interdisciplinary dialogue that establishes a new set of models and predecessors. This dialogue is used to explore a variety of issues in Cervantes including the absence of a single guiding pictorial program, the doubling of archaeological reconstruction, and the use of ekphrasis as allusion, interpolation, and an integral component of the action. Quixotic Frescoes delves into the politics of imitation, self-censorship, religious ideology expressed through the pictorial, as well as the gendering of art as reflected in Cervantes' work. This detailed and exhaustive study is an invaluable contribution to both Hispanic and Renaissance studies"--Provided by publisher.

Die Literatur der Moderne um 1900 reflektiert eine ikonische Wende im Verhältnis zwischen dem kulturellen Leitmedium der Schrift und der Konkurrenz der Bilder. Herausgefordert vom Evidenzversprechen der malerischen Avantgarde, des frühen Kinos, der Sprach- und Bewusstseinsbilder erproben Autoren wie Hofmannsthal, Rilke und Musil eine Sprache der visionären Grenzüberschreitung, die sich im Erschreiben des anderen Mediums doch stets der eigenen Mittel bewusst ist. Die Studie geht den poetologischen Konsequenzen des spezifischen Bildwissens der literarischen Moderne nach und rekonstruiert dessen wissensgeschichtliche Kontexte.

Die vorliegende Studie bewegt sich im Bereich von Ethik und Ästhetik, um bei zwei so konträr erscheinenden intellektuellen Repräsentanten der Moderne wie dem 'Idealisten' Schiller und dem 'Zyniker' Benn eine gemeinsame, im Vertrauen auf die "rettende" Kraft der Kunst verwandte Tradition ästhetischer Theoriebildung aufzudecken. Im Horizont von Metaphysikverlust und Erkenntniszweifel und angesichts der epochalen politisch-gesellschaftlichen Umbrüche ihrer Zeit analysierten beide Dichter diese Krisen mit einem Deutungsmuster, das die Kunst funktional an die Stelle der Religion rückt. Im Falle Benns, wo diese "Kunstmetaphysik" zeitweilig mit konkreten, an die Politik geknüpften Verwirklichungshoffnungen aufgeladen war, wird das Ästhetische damit in gefährlicher Weise überlastet.
